HTC announced two new Windows Phone 7 Mango powered devices today, the HTC Radar and the HTC Titan. The Radar is a low-end budget-conscious device, while the Titan sits atop the high end, sporting a 4.7″ display, HTC’s biggest screen on a phone to date.
